With the advent of Internet of things (IoT), there is a need to provide energy for a massive number of smart tiny devices without using large, heavy, and high maintenance batteries. One promising way is to harvest energy from the environment and store it into an energy buffer such as a capacitor. In this way, programs are being executed as long as there is available energy in the capacitor, and crash when it exhausts. Recently, different software and hardware based checkpointing strategies have been proposed to make forward progress toward execution for energy harvesting IoT devices. This thesis introduces two different software solutions based on static and dynamic compilation. The proposed static compiler inserts checkpoints based on st...
Historically, malware (MW) analysis has heavily resorted to human savvy for manual signature creatio...
Reduced width units are ones of the power reduction methods. However such units have been mostly eva...
les travaux de recherche de Jean-François Nezan s'inscrivent dans le cadre général des méthodes et o...
The research interests presented in this "Habilitation" revolve around application specific hardware...
Technological limitations faced by the semi-conductor manufacturers in the early 2000's restricted t...
Riding the wave of smart disclosure initiatives and new privacy-protection regulations, the Personal...
The sequence comparison process is one of the main bioinformatics task. The new sequencing technolog...
Parallel programs need to manage the trade-off between the time spent in synchronisation and computa...
Hardware compression techniques are typically simplifications of software compression methods. They ...
Malgré les avantages de l'intégration 3D, le test, le rendement et la fiabilité des Through-Silicon-...
In recent years, the research focus has moved from core microarchitecture to uncore microarchitectur...
Multiprocessor system on chip (MPSoC) such as the CELL processor or the more recent Platform2012 are...
The Internet changed the lives of network users: not only it affects users' habits, but it is also i...
Many tools exist to solve constrained path-planning problems. They can be classified as follows. In ...
The increasing number of worldwide mobile platforms and the emergence of new technologies such as th...
Historically, malware (MW) analysis has heavily resorted to human savvy for manual signature creatio...
Reduced width units are ones of the power reduction methods. However such units have been mostly eva...
les travaux de recherche de Jean-François Nezan s'inscrivent dans le cadre général des méthodes et o...
The research interests presented in this "Habilitation" revolve around application specific hardware...
Technological limitations faced by the semi-conductor manufacturers in the early 2000's restricted t...
Riding the wave of smart disclosure initiatives and new privacy-protection regulations, the Personal...
The sequence comparison process is one of the main bioinformatics task. The new sequencing technolog...
Parallel programs need to manage the trade-off between the time spent in synchronisation and computa...
Hardware compression techniques are typically simplifications of software compression methods. They ...
Malgré les avantages de l'intégration 3D, le test, le rendement et la fiabilité des Through-Silicon-...
In recent years, the research focus has moved from core microarchitecture to uncore microarchitectur...
Multiprocessor system on chip (MPSoC) such as the CELL processor or the more recent Platform2012 are...
The Internet changed the lives of network users: not only it affects users' habits, but it is also i...
Many tools exist to solve constrained path-planning problems. They can be classified as follows. In ...
The increasing number of worldwide mobile platforms and the emergence of new technologies such as th...
Historically, malware (MW) analysis has heavily resorted to human savvy for manual signature creatio...
Reduced width units are ones of the power reduction methods. However such units have been mostly eva...
les travaux de recherche de Jean-François Nezan s'inscrivent dans le cadre général des méthodes et o...